Bhubaneswar, May 20: 
The results of the +2 examinations conducted by the Council of Higher Secondary Education (CHSE) were announced on Wednesday, with students from Kalinga Institute of Social Sciences (KISS) achieving commendable success in the examinations.

While the overall pass percentages in the state stood at 84.50% in Arts, 88.80% in Science, and 88.07% in Commerce, KISS recorded an encouraging performance across all streams. A total of 1,847 students from KISS appeared for the +2 examinations this year.

Continuing the trend of previous years, girl students of KISS outperformed the boys. More than 50% of the students secured first division marks. In Arts and Commerce streams, five students each scored above 90%, while seven students in Science secured more than 90% marks.

Neha Kujur emerged as the college topper in Arts with 91% marks. In Science, Saribala Munda became the topper with 96%, while Shashimani Majhi topped the Commerce stream with 91% marks.

Expressing happiness over the results, Achyuta Samanta, Founder of KIIT and KISS, congratulated all the students for their success in the Class XII examinations. He said that the dedication of the faculty members of KISS College, their continuous guidance to students, and the relentless hard work of the students have brought this success to the institution.
